Newmarket's Council Priorities will act as the roadmap for continued community success through the current term of Council (2022-2026) and beyond, helping to guide Newmarket towards and even brighter future.

The five Council Priorities are:

  • Community and economic vibrancy – Attracting and retaining amazing people and businesses to ensure Newmarket's long-term viability through sustainable jobs, while creating a strong and unique brand that differentiates Newmarket from other communities.
  • Customer-first way of life (enhanced by technology) – Ensuring the community has timely access to services that enhance their quality of life.
  • Extraordinary places and spaces – Creating exceptional experiences for the community in shared and accessible public spaces.
  • Environmental sustainability – Preserving our environmental assets and addressing climate change for future generations.
  • Diverse, welcoming, and inclusive community – Building a strong, healthy and equitable community where everyone feels an unwavering sense of belonging.
